What companies run services between AnnoDomini, Rome, Italy and Piazza del Popolo, Lazio, Italy?

ATAC S.p.A. Azienda per la mobilità operates a bus from Baldo Degli Ubaldi/Moricca to P.Le Flaminio every 10 minutes. Tickets cost €2–7 and the journey takes 22 min. Alternatively, ATAC S.p.A. Azienda per la mobilità operates a subway from Baldo Degli Ubaldi to Flaminio every 10 minutes. Tickets cost €2 and the journey takes 9 min.
